تفاوت هاب و سوئیچ شبکه در چیست؟
هاب و سوئیچ اترنت، هر دو، تجهیزات شبکهای هستند که رایانهها و دستگاههای IP را به یکدیگر متصل میکنند. هاب دارای قابلیتهای انتقال داده سادهای است. این دستگاه، دادهها را بر اساس آدرس MAC تجهیزات و از طریق لایه یک شبکه (لایه فیزیکی) به آنها ارسال میکند. سوئیچ شبکه اما داری پیچیدگی بیشتری است. این دستگاه، امنیت، کارایی، عملکرد هوشمند و قابلیت انتقال به آدرسهای MAC خاص درون شبکه را از طریق لایه ۲ و لایه ۳ ارائه میدهد.
لایه 1 و 2 و 3 شبکه چیست؟
لایهها مسیرهایی هستند که دادهها از طریق آنها ارسال میشوند. استانداردهای Open Systems Intercommunication (OSI) لایهها را به عنوان مدلی برای ارتباط از طریق شبکه تعریف میکند. در تصویر زیر، لایههایی از شبکه را میبینید که هابها و سوئیچهای اترنت بر روی آنها عملکرد درون شبکهای را انجام میدهند. هاب و سوئیج شبکه، این کار را با هدف قرار دادن آدرسهای MAC دستگاهها انجام میدهند.
مک آدرس چست؟
MAC مخفف Media Access Control، یک آدرس 48 یا 64 بیتی است که در زمان ساخت رایانه به یک آداپتور شبکه داده شده است. آدرس MAC یک دستگاه، در واقع آدرس سخت افزاری آن است. از طرف دیگر، آدرس IP یک آدرس نرم افزاری است. هر دوی اینها را میتوان در کارت رابط شبکه (NIC) یک رایانه خاص یافت. این آدرسها به هر دو دستگاه هاب و سوئیچ اجازه میدهند که دادهها را به رایانه منتقل کنند.
اکنون که آدرس رایانه دریافت کننده و مسیری که یک سیگنال طی میکند تا به مقصد برسد را فهمیدید، بیایید نحوه انتقال داده از طریق هاب و سوئیچ به آنها را بررسی کنیم.
هاب
هاب، دادهها را از طریق فرآیندی به نام frame flooding که به نام unicast نیز شناخته میشود به رایانههای درون یک شبکه محلی (LAN) ارسال میکند. این فرایند، مانند یک انفجار بزرگ است. یک هاب، بین آدرسهای MAC تفاوتی قائل نمیشود و در واقع نرم افزار مورد نیاز برای شناسایی دستگاه خاص مقصد را ندارد.
هاب در اصل یک دستگاه غیرهوشمند است. هر بیت ورودی به همه پورتهای هاب و در نتیجه به تمام دستگاهای متصل فرستاده میشود. هاب ساده ترین و کم هزینه ترین راه برای ایجاد شبکهای از رایانه های شخصی با هم است.
یکی از مشکلات هابها ترافیک غیر ضروری به دلیل فرآیند ارسال دادهها به تمام پورتها است. این دستگاه همچنین از ایمنی بالایی برخوردار نیست، زیرا برخلاف سوئیچ شبکه، نمیتواند دادهها را فیلتر کند. هاب دادههایی را به همه پورتهای خروجی خود ارسال میکند که برای همه کاربران نهایی در نظر گرفته نشده است. یک هاب به طور کلی دارای 4 تا 12 پورت است.
سوئیچ شبکه
سوئیچ، یک دستگاه هوشمند است که دادهها را به آدرسهای MAC خاصی در شبکه LAN ارسال میکند. در واقع این دستگاه، قابلیت یادگیری یا “به خاطر سپردن” و تمایز بین آدرسهای مک دستگاهای داخل شبکه را دارد. سوئیچ برای دسترسی به این آدرسها، از جدولی به نام جدول CAM بهره میبرد.
نرم افزار سوئیچ، این امکان را برای آن فراهم میکند که ترافیک را تنظیم کند. همچنین سیگنالهای اضافی را حذف کند و در نتیجه، شبکه متصل را بسیار کارآمدتر بسازد. در قیاس سوئیچ و هاب باید گفت که شبکهای که از سوئیچ استفاده میکند، هزینه بیشتری خواهد داشت، اما نه تنها از رایانههای شخصی، بلکه از انواع دستگاههای IP دیگر نیز پشتیبانی میکند.
هوشمندی و ویژگیهای قدرتمند سوئیچ، آن را به قلمرو اینترنت و توانایی پشتیبانی از دستگاههای راه دور در یک VLAN ،WAN یا LAN بزرگتر میآورد. ویژگیهای هوشمند سوئیچ به مدیران شبکه این امکان را میدهد که پورتها را خاموش و روشن کنند. ارسال دادهها را از طریق پورتهای خاص فیلتر کنند و بدین ترتیب امنیت VLAN را مدیریت کنند. یک سوئیچ شبکه به طور کلی دارای 24 تا 48 پورت است.